The protocol is built on the Sui blockchain which allows it to operate smoothly at scale. This foundation gives Walrus the ability to handle large amounts of data without slowing down or becoming expensive. Instead of storing files in one fragile location Walrus breaks them into smaller pieces and distributes them across a decentralized network. This approach means that even if part of the network fails the data remains intact. It mirrors the idea that important things in life should never depend on one single point of failure.

The WAL token is what keeps this ecosystem alive. It is used to access storage secure the network and take part in governance. Holding and staking WAL is not just a financial activity. It is a sign of belief in the system. Governance allows the community to shape the future together which creates trust and emotional connection. Users are not outsiders. They are participants builders and decision makers.
